Associate Director, Creative Production & Development
About The Position | Major goals and objectives and location requirements
As the Associate Director, Creative Production & Development your role is a hybrid of creative strategy and hands-on execution, responsible for developing and pitching original, platform-native video concepts while also directing shoots and guiding the post-production process. The Associate Director owns the complete creative lifecycle of assigned video projects, from initial concept through final delivery, while acting as a primary creative voice for their productions, ensuring all content is innovative, aligns with brand strategy, and drives audience growth on key platforms like YouTube.
This role will serve as a senior creative leader on the Central Creative team, dedicated to producing best-in-class video, for both celebrity and non-celebrity content for our iconic brands. The Associate Director displays an 'all hands on deck' and 'can-do' attitude. They are the driving force behind their shoots – creative innovators and stewards of the brands.
Hybrid 3x a week- (NYC or LA)
In-office Expectations: This position is hybrid in-office, with the ability to work remotely for up to 2 days per week.
About The Positions Contributions:
• Creative Development: Work closely with Sr. Director on creative ideating, developing and executing unique, original concepts and formats for new series and videos that are tailored to platform best practices and strategic brand goals. Rigorously research lanes, topics and talent for established or potential series.
• Production & Directing: Direct multi-camera and doc-style video shoots, managing both celebrity and non-celebrity talent on set or remotely to execute the creative vision and capture compelling content.
• Project Ownership: Manage the entire project scope, timeline, and budget in close partnership with the Production & Post Operations team to ensure projects are delivered on time and on budget.
• Post-Production Guidance: Lead the post-production process for your projects, providing clear, constructive creative feedback to editors to guide storytelling, pacing, and style from first cut to final delivery.
• Stakeholder Partnership: Serve as the primary point of contact and creative partner for brand stakeholders on your assigned projects, effectively communicating the creative vision and managing feedback.
The Role's Minimum Qualifications and Job Requirements:
• 5-7+ years of experience in digital video production, with a proven track record of both developing and producing high-performing Youtube-first content.
• Expertise in creatively leading projects from concept to completion, including pitching, scripting, directing, and overseeing post-production.
• A strong creative storyteller with a deep understanding of what drives engagement and audience growth on YouTube and other digital platforms.
• Experience directing documentary-style videos, and interviewing both celebrity and non-celebrity talent in a variety of production environments.
• Excellent communication and collaboration skills, with experience managing feedback from multiple stakeholders.
• Highly organized, self-motivated, and comfortable managing multiple projects simultaneously in a fast-paced, deadline-oriented environment.
• An active consumer of digital video and hyper aware of cultural trends and how they can influence the development of new formats.
• Passionate, curious and willing to collaborate, test and learn
